PARIS
Paris' Criminal Court has sentenced British businessman Ian Griffin to 20 years in prison for murdering his millionaire girlfriend in a luxury hotel suite in 2009.
After five hours of deliberations, the French court ruled late Friday that Griffin, who is 45, had intentionally killed Kinga Legg, who was 36.
The prosecutor had sought a 25-year sentence.
Griffin has denied the charges, saying he remembered nothing of the night of his partner's death.
A maid found the battered body of Legg lying in a bathtub in the blood-stained luxury suite, which investigators described as a scene of "frenzied violence."
Investigators said Legg suffered 100 injuries, including a massive blow to the head. Police found Griffin in a tent in the woods in Britain and he was extradited to France.
